1. Your Siding Is Your First Line of Defense

Siding protects your home from rain, wind, UV rays, and temperature swings. Over time, all of that exposure can lead to cracks, warping, mold growth, and hidden moisture damage. These issues often start small and go unnoticed until they turn into expensive repairs.


A routine Merton siding inspection helps homeowners catch these problems early. Just like a roof check can spot a few missing shingles before a leak happens, a siding inspection can reveal gaps or soft spots before water makes its way into your walls.

2. Early Detection Saves You Thousands


When siding damage goes unnoticed, water can sneak behind the panels and begin to rot the sheathing or framing of your home. Once that happens, you’re no longer dealing with just a cosmetic fix. You’re looking at structural damage that requires serious repairs.


Professional siding inspections help you avoid those big-ticket repairs by catching the little things. A small crack might only take a quick patch or a panel replacement. But left alone, it could lead to insulation damage, mold, and even pest infestations. That’s why a few hundred dollars for a thorough inspection now could save you thousands later.

3. Storm Damage Isn’t Always Obvious


Merton weather can be unpredictable. Between heavy rains, hail, and strong winds, your home’s exterior takes a beating throughout the year. After a major storm, you might inspect your roof...but what about your siding?


Hail can leave behind dents or micro-cracks. Wind can pull panels loose. And even if the damage isn’t visible from the street, it may still be putting your home at risk. A professional inspection after a storm helps document any damage, which is especially helpful if you need to file an insurance claim.

5. It’s Not a DIY Job


You might be tempted to walk around your home and do a quick visual check, and while that’s a good habit, it won’t catch everything. Many siding issues happen below the surface or in places you can’t easily see.


A professional knows where to look and what to look for. They have the tools to check behind panels, spot moisture intrusion, and assess the overall health of your exterior. They can also give honest recommendations and provide an action plan to keep your siding in top shape.


6. When Should You Schedule an Inspection?


Ideally, you should have your siding inspected at least once a year, with additional checks after major storms. Spring and fall are great times to schedule inspections so you can prepare for extreme weather on either end.


If your siding is older, if you notice your energy bills creeping up, or if you've had a recent storm roll through Merton, don’t wait. The sooner you catch potential issues, the more you can save.
